2019 BMW 125i review

The BMW 1 Series has long been something of an oddity in the premium small-hatchback segment, but for all the right reasons, being the only rear-driven competitor since it launched in 2004. Unlike its rivals, the 1er wasn't just an affordable front-drive hatchback with a luxury badge stuck on its nose. From the start, the 1 Series has been rear-wheel drive, though this is set to change with the new-generation model due to debut later this year.
